The flexibility of one muscle is strongly influenced by the strength of the opposing muscle.

Not just the opposing muscle but the stabilizing muscles of a joint. If you have some weakness in a couple of the rotator cuff muscles then you will have some tightness in some of the other cuff muscles or adjoining muscles. If you have some hip weakness then it might show up as hamstring tightness or ITB tightness etc.
To tie it in with golf--how fit do you need to be to play your best? You need to be as fit and flexible as you need to be for you to make roughly the same quality swing on # 17 and 18 that you made after the driving range warm-up or after a couple of holes. If you can do that fine -if not-if you're a bit more tight, feel a little tired, notice you lost a bit of zing etc then you'll improve your score by improving your body.
